About The Position

This position will obtain packaging equipment and materials and deliver items to customers. It involves planning truck routes for economical use of time and equipment, performing routine vehicle inspections, and maintaining a clean truck and work area. The role requires adherence to safety and security standards, accurate recording of material movements, and assisting with receiving, managing paperwork, counting, tagging, and putting away materials in the warehouse. Efficiency, teamwork, and maintaining a specified housekeeping zone are also key aspects of this role. The position also requires completing all required continuous learning training, including safety, compliance, and job-specific modules.
